Acelle Mail Installation: Troubleshooting Common Issues

Setting up Acelle Mail can sometimes present difficulties , and encountering installation problems is quite common. Below are a few typical issues and how to fix them. Firstly, ensure your server complies with the minimum system requirements – notably PHP version, MySQL/MariaDB, and available disk space . Frequently , insufficient PHP extensions (like `gd`, `mysqli`, `curl`) are the main cause of installation problems. Double-check your file settings – they need to be accurately configured for the Acelle Mail files to be writable . If you’re employing a server environment, examine for any firewall restrictions or SELinux configurations that might be preventing the installation procedure . Finally, carefully review the Acelle Mail error log for detailed error messages; these often provide valuable insights to the problem.
